Unique challenges for pharma field teams
HCP visit density and territory complexity
Medical representatives often complete 8–12 physician visits per day across urban and rural territories. Managers need visibility into coverage gaps, not surveillance of personal time. Shift-session GPS — tracking only during active work periods — provides route history and presence verification without violating labor privacy regulations in the EU, UK, US, and APAC markets.
Mileage reimbursement at scale
Pharma field forces are among the highest-mileage workforces in B2B enterprise. A 300-rep organization at average regional driving patterns can process 15,000+ mileage claims monthly. Manual verification is impossible. Road-distance calculation from GPS point sequences — not straight-line estimates or employee-reported odometer readings — is the accounts standard for audit-ready reimbursement.
Expense categories and compliance
Pharma field expenses extend beyond travel: client meals, conference attendance, sample logistics, and equipment. Each category requires policy limits, approval routing, and permanent audit records. Platforms with 30+ configurable expense categories and four-tier limit hierarchies (personal, band, category, global) replace policy documents that reps ignore and accounts teams cannot enforce.
Multi-market deployment
Global pharma operates across jurisdictions with different mileage rates, tax rules, and location monitoring laws. Enterprise platforms support miles and kilometers, configurable rates per employee band or territory, and tenant-isolated data for each commercial entity or affiliate.

Implementation playbook for pharma commercial operations
1. Define shift policies — Align with labor counsel on when GPS capture activates and ends
2. Map territories to employee bands — Configure reimbursement rates by region and role level
3. Set expense categories — Enable pharma-specific limits for meals, travel, conferences, and samples
4. Train managers on live dashboard — Coverage analysis, not micromanagement
5. Integrate accounts export — Monthly mileage and expense rollups to payroll and ERP
6. Enable MobiTraq — Proactive discrepancy review before reimbursement cycles close
